در حال حاضر محصولی در سبد خرید شما وجود ندارد.
طراحی امن برای ساخت و استقرار برنامه های امن جاوا ضروری است. اما، حتی بهترین طرح ها می تواند به برنامه های ناامن منجر شود، اگر توسعه دهندگان از مشکلات متعدد امنیتی بالقوه در برنامه نویسی جاوا آگاه نیستند.
این دوره با توضیح دقیق از خطاهای برنامه ریزی مشترک که در جاوا مواجه شده است، آغاز می شود. علاوه بر این، شما را از طریق مسائل امنیتی به زبان های برنامه نویسی جاوا و کتابخانه های مرتبط می گیرد. بعدها، بینش هایی را درباره شیوه های برنامه نویسی ضعیف که منجر به کد آسیب پذیر و نحوه استفاده از ایمن و حفظ شیوه های توسعه ایمن در طول چرخه زندگی توسعه نرم افزار می شود، جمع آوری می کنید.
در این دوره، شما در مورد دفاع از اعتبار سنجی ورودی که می توانید به دست آورید برای محافظت در برابر آسیب پذیری های کاربردی مشترک استفاده می شود، و همچنین یادگیری تست امنیت نرم افزار برای برنامه های کاربردی وب برای ارزیابی آسیب پذیری ها. علاوه بر این، شما خواهید آموخت که چگونه با استفاده از چارچوب امنیتی بهار، یک احراز هویت قدرتمند و بسیار قابل تنظیم و چارچوب کنترل دسترسی، از برنامه های جاوا استفاده کنید.
عنوان اصلی : Secure Programming with Java
سرفصل های دوره :
01 فصل 1: معرفی امنیت جاوا:
001 001 Overview دوره
002 درک نرم افزار امنیت، تهدیدات و حملات
003 آسیب پذیری های تاریخی و سوء استفاده ها
004 مدل امنیتی جاوا
02 فصل 2: طراحی نرم افزار امن:
001 مقدمه ای برای طراحی امن
002 جمع آوری نیازهای امنیتی
003 مدل سازی تهدید برنامه
004 طراحی نرم افزار امن و معماری
005 استقرار امن و تعمیر و نگهداری
03 فصل 3: شیوه های برنامه نویسی امن برای رمزنگاری:
001 مقدمه ای بر رمزنگاری جاوا
002 با استفاده از معماری رمزنگاری جاوا و API های شخص ثالث
003 خطای رمزنگاری مشترک
04 فصل 4: شیوه های کدگذاری امن برای مدیریت خطا:
001 مقدمه ای بر استثناء جاوا
002 شکست خورده به درستی رسیدگی به استثنا
003 داده های خطا در پیام های خطا
05 فصل 5: همزمان و شرایط مسابقه:
001 مقدمه ای بر هماهنگی
002 مدل حافظه جاوا
003 همزمان و آسیب پذیری شرایط مسابقه
06 فصل 6: همبستگی و آسیب پذیری شرایط مسابقه:
001 مقدمه ای بر برنامه های کاربردی وب جاوا
002 تأمین ارتباطات با extension Secure Secure جاوا (JSSE)
003 خدمات خدمات وب و امنیت
004 004 تأسیسات ورودی و اعتبار سنجی
07 فصل 7: شیوه های برنامه نویسی امن برای احراز هویت، مجوز، و مدیریت جلسه:
001 مقدمه ای بر احراز هویت و مجوز
002 002 احراز هویت جاوا و خدمات مجوز (JAAS)
003 تأیید اعتبار و کنترل دسترسی با چارچوب امنیتی بهار
08 فصل 8: تست امنیت نرم افزار استاتیک و پویا:
001 مقدمه ای بر تست امنیت نرم افزار
002 بررسی کد دستی
003 با استفاده از ابزارهای تجزیه و تحلیل استاتیک
004 تست امنیت برنامه کاربردی پویا
005 005 ادغام کد بازبینی به SDLC
Secure Programming with Java
در این روش نیاز به افزودن محصول به سبد خرید و تکمیل اطلاعات نیست و شما پس از وارد کردن ایمیل خود و طی کردن مراحل پرداخت لینک های دریافت محصولات را در ایمیل خود دریافت خواهید کرد.